Output ec678b947f5496facb677bce49a8d1210cb40871cd7ab1c99616bdf33058c386:0

value
40980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e91dab90ff1332ed7cf3a052d59c535db80cf85 OP_EQUAL
address
3EgrbvYvQzkxRHG6xKoYeWY3r7Qyd78RQX
transaction
ec678b947f5496facb677bce49a8d1210cb40871cd7ab1c99616bdf33058c386
confirmations
288318
spent
true